South Africa is rich in mineral resources and is one of the five largest mineral resource countries in the world. There are more than 70 kinds of minerals that have been proven and mined. The reserves of platinum group metals, fluorspar and chromium rank first in the world, gold, vanadium...
Woodcarving is an important informal sector industry that is heavily dependent on tourism and yet sustains the livelihoods of many migrant communities in South Africa. In the Cape Town area, the trade appears to be dominated by sellers from neighbouring countries, including Zimbabwe, Malawi and the...
